MVR Evaporator for Smelting Wastewater Treatment

Project description: smelting wastewater treatment;

Equipment: MVR evaporator;

Main composition of feedstock: sodium chloride, sodium sulfate and etc;

PH of feedstock: slightly alkaline;

Evaporation capacity: 8,000.00kg/hr;

Construction material: product wetted parts adopt SS316L, non wetted parts adopt SS 304 or carbons steel per actual need.

Project Description

    Smelting wastewater treatment project, and A MVR Evaporator is adopted. MVR evaporator, is an evaporation and concentration equipment with mechanical vapor recompression (thereinafter abbreviated MVR), recycling the secondary steam completely with compression.

Process Technology   

    A MVR evaporator is adopted to concentrate the smelting wastewater which contains sodium chloride and sodium sulfate mainly to saturated. After concentration, the oversaturated liquor was delivered into a centrifuge to be solid-liquor separated, the filtered salts was discharged or recycled, and the mother liquor was returned to the evaporator system to be concentrated again. 

Equipment Description 

1 set of MVR and forced circulation evaporator is adopted for smelting wastewater treatment, is able to meet the following demands:

1). the smelting wastewater was concentrated to oversaturated, and then was filtered by a centrifuge to separate crystal salts from mother liquor, and the mother liquor was returned to evaporator system;

2). All components in the plant are well designed to ensure safety in production;

3). The forced circulation evaporator system can effectively prevent the blocking risk of heat exchange tubes caused by high concentration, and can slow the formation of scaling on the heat exchange surface at the mean time, improve the heat transfer efficiency, increase the continuous operation time of equipment, and reduce the cleaning frequency;

4). The main configuration of the plant is as below:

     a. One set of forced circulation evaporator;

     b. One set of MVR device;

     c. One set of demister system for ensure the quality of secondary steam entering the MVR device, to ensure the service life of the MVR device;

     d. One set of DSC control system.
